Abstract

The dehydrate amination of alcohols was investigated in water using sulfonic calix[6]resorcinarene and acid. A series of aminations were synthesized in high yields. The structures were characterized by 1H NMR and 13C NMR speetra. Water-soluble sulfonic calix[6]resorcinarene could be reused times and without a loss of catalytic efficiency.
